你查询的IP:[202.93.22.138]  地理位置:印度尼西亚

最新查询122.209.128.108 117.124.185.146 121.46.246.159 58.128.96.123 124.192.244.24 119.48.114.0 118.64.113.61 117.8.55.69 121.59.245.80 202.93.22.138 121.56.80.255 59.32.184.182 221.200.150.155 203.176.168.202 202.170.216.69 123.99.128.72 121.224.186.83 202.189.80.14 168.160.195.13 118.66.254.20 120.52.13.101 122.102.64.152 119.31.192.175 125.169.45.228 119.232.178.17 203.208.15.33 118.120.227.65 116.199.128.254 60.208.105.40 203.100.80.141 222.126.128.4